Property Details for 85/13-15 Hassall St, Parramatta

85/13-15 Hassall St, Parramatta is a 1 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it and was built in 2003. The property has a floor size of 50m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2023.

About Parramatta 2150

The size of Parramatta is approximately 5.5 square kilometres. It has 29 parks covering nearly 23.8% of total area. The population of Parramatta in 2011 was 19,744 people. By 2016 the population was 25,788 showing a population growth of 30.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Parramatta is 30-39 years. Households in Parramatta are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Parramatta work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 35.9% of the homes in Parramatta were owner-occupied compared with 28.1% in 2016.

Parramatta has 19,329 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Parramatta have seen a 71.69%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 8.12%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Parramatta is $1,717,774 while the median value for Units is $611,632.
  • Houses have a median rent of $650 while Units have a median rent of $640.
There are currently 189 properties listed for sale, and 166 properties listed for rent in Parramatta on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 1047 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Parramatta.
